Salary Guide for Teachers in Gunbalanya

📊 Teacher salaries in Gunbalanya exceed national averages due to remote Zone 5 allowances (up to 51.2% loading + $22,000 housing). Graduates start $82,343 base + incentives = $110k total; experienced $120k-$150k. Factors: Qualifications (Masters +5%), subject shortages (+10%), performance bonuses.

Cost of living low (index 85 vs national 100); groceries $400/month, subsidized utilities. Superannuation 11.5%, plus NT extras like district allowance. Vs Darwin ($75k-$115k), Gunbalanya pays 20-30% more effectively.

RoleEntry Salary (AUD)Experienced (AUD)Remote Total
Primary Teacher$82k$110k$130k+
Secondary Teacher$85k$115k$140k+
Special Ed$88k$120k$145k+
Principal-$160k$190k+

Weather and Climate in Gunbalanya

☀️ Gunbalanya's tropical savanna climate features wet season (Nov-Apr: 30-35°C, 1,500mm rain, humid) with cyclones rare, and dry season (May-Oct: 25-32°C, sunny, low humidity). Impacts: Wet term limits outdoor play; dry enables bush excursions, fishing at Injalak Falls.

Tips: Acclimatize with hydration; best visits May-Sep. Schools adapt with air-con, wet-season indoor programs. Enhances lifestyle—stargazing, wildlife spotting.
